What is sidecar country music?

Sidecar country is one of the latest incarnations of Texas country music. Springing from the foundations of country rock from the late 1960's and outlaw country from the early 1970's, this band fuses musical styles from such artists as Graham Parsons, the Flying Burrito Brothers, the Byrds, Willis Alan Ramsey, CCR, the Eagles, B.W.Stevenson, Willie Nelson and Hank Williams III. Radio TeXXas creates a unique blend of old style country and rock music with a dash of the intangible ingredient called sidecar country.

Meet the Musicians


Louis "Buckaroo Lou" Siedlecki – Lead Vocals

From San Antonio but currently residing between Luling and Harwood, Texas, Louis was as a youngster, the original vocalist for the Hangmen and the Five Canadians. Their single “Writing on the Wall” hit the “top ten” in Canada and Los Angeles airplay markets. This group was featured in the periodical Brown Sack (1997) as one of the prime innovators of the garage/punk sound with featured article references to Louis as one of the premier vocalists and songwriters. Since that time, Louis has performed in a number of musical genres with a number of groups including the Seldom Heard Band, T.T. Thunderbeard, and the Trash Rockets and has toured with the Chris Hillman Band and Gene Clark (former co-founders of the Bryds) as well as shared the stage with such legendary notables as Peter Rowan (the Flying Burrito Brothers).

Chris Lange - Harmony Vocals, Guitar

Chris Lange, from Seguin Texas, is relatively new to the music scene but is making a grand entry. As a vocalist and songwriter for the band "Fairly Smashed", his song "Safe with Me" was a big hit on LaLa.com (since purchased by Apple Inc's iTunes). Chris has contributed his guitar stylings and song writing talents to help create the unique sound for the CD "Turn the Radio On".

Ashley Duderstadt – Lead Vocals, Harmony Vocals

Ashley has been singing all of her life - she started singing professionally at the age of 16 with Bobby Allen Jones. Ashley graduated with a bachelor’s degree in music from Texas State University, has appeared previously with Smokey Wilson and other local bands and now fronts and her current band, Mindset. Her musical style stems from classic country but is filtered through the influence of heavy rock resulting in an extremely versatile vocal ability. Ashley currently lives in San Marcos where she is pursuing her dream of being a full-time singer. With her commanding voice, emotional performance style, and sweetheart personality, you can expect big things to come from Ashley in the future.

Mike Harris - Lead Guitars, Dobro, Fiddle

Mike cut his musical eye teeth playing in southeast Texas in the 60's. He played in Austin and Fort Worth clubs in the mid-70's, then moved on to the Denton and Dallas area in the late 70's. After some years away from the band scene, he resumed in the late 80's, working back in Austin with Jimmy Carl Black, Arthur Brown, and producer Kim Fowley among others. Besides his involvement with Radio TeXXas, his recent work includes numerous performances with Amanda Pearcy as well as with former Balcones Fault frontman Fletcher Clark. Mike teaches extensively and operates Austin Piano and Strings Studio with his wife, singer/songwriter Wendy Murphy.

Howard Gloor – Steel Guitar

From Shiner, Texas comes Howard Gloor, a man of many talents. Howard was a guitar slinger from the legendary progressive rock band Homer but today he plays with Los Kolaches, Bill Pekkar, and others around central Texas but never too far from Shiner - that’s where there is a cozy little beer garden behind “Howards”, his local convenience store and public hangout with nine beers on tap. Howard’s pedal steel guitar licks tastefully frame this collection of songs in toe-tapping style.

Randy Sulsar - Bass, Guitars, Banjitar, Percussion

Randy played the tuba in school and later guitar and drums. Recently, he played bass with Slaves of Utopia, the LaserTones and the Flying Dollar Bunkhouse Band. In Lockhart, Texas, he operates Creek Bottom Music where he recorded and mixed the CD “Turn the Radio On”. His performances both on the upright and the electric bass and his rhythmic percussion form the foundation groove for these tracks while his guitar and banjitar add spicey accents throughout.
